How they compare

Samoa currently reports 32.3% against 31.6% in Senegal, a difference of 0.7%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 17 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Senegal ahead.

Samoa ranks 140th and Senegal ranks 141st of 190 countries.

Senegal has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Samoa Senegal Difference Ahead
2000s 24.1% 31.8% 7.7% Senegal
2010s 30.5% 31.8% 1.2% Senegal

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
